Postural examination consists of three parts: examining alignment in standing, testing flexibility and muscle length, and testing muscle strength. The document outlines various methods for assessing posture, including visual observation, plumbline, goniometry, photography, radiography, and photogrammetry. It also covers assessing body type, different views of posture, flexibility tests, and using the information to determine weak muscles and potential underlying pathologies.
